Unfamiliar vehicle reported suspicious but belonged to fire memberAmsterdam NY

audio iconSuspicious Activity
Near Riverview Dr, Amsterdam, NY 12010

A suspicious vehicle was reported parked near Riverview Drive in Amsterdam. The vehicle was unfamiliar and unoccupied. Officers later found it belonged to a fire department member who had run out of gas.
